American vacationer arrested in Tokyo for defacing shrine gate

A 65-year-old American vacationer has been arrested in Japan for allegedly defacing a picket gate at a shrine in Tokyo, in line with native police.

Steve Lee Hayes has reportedly admitted to writing “his family member’s names” on the pillar of a torii gate on the Meiji Shrine within the Shibuya ward of Tokyo on Tuesday, the Japan Occasions reported.

Torii gates, buildings discovered on the entrance of Shinto shrines throughout Japan, symbolize the transition from the mundane to the sacred. The Meiji Shrine was established in 1920 in honor of Emperor Meiji, Japan’s 112nd emperor who ascended to the throne in 1867, and his spouse Empress Shoken.

The alleged incident occurred simply after 11 a.m. on Tuesday. In accordance with the police’s worldwide crime division, the American, whose deal with and occupation haven’t been disclosed, used his fingernails to etch 5 letters into one of many gates.

Investigators used safety digicam footage to arrest Hayes, who arrived in Japan together with his household on Monday. He was detained at his Tokyo resort two days afterward suspicion of property harm.

It was not instantly clear if Hayes remained in custody on Thursday.
